Web page shortcut!

Hi, I have a web page shortcut that has appeared on my desktop. In fact there are two that keep appearing on boot. One is Get rid of spyware, the other I can't remember. I am surprised that these have got onto the system as I am running Norton Internet Security.

Obviously deleting them does no good, as they must be embedded somewhere in the registry. Anyone know of the key(s) that I can delete or edit to get rid of these, or indeed any other way to get rid of them.
